What is "use smaller panning rate"
It is placed on gear icon>screen>e-ink settings>use smaller panning rate. "use smaller panning rate" is enabled by default but when I disable it what will happen?
My device is Kobo Glo HD |

It sets a lower "refreshes per second" when scrolling (2 vs 30). It is enabled by default on eink devices.
Most people wil want to leave it enabled. Some android users with modern Onyx/Likebook devices and A2 enabled can disable it without pain. |
